This is a tracking bug for Change: Changes/GCC10 For more details, see: https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Changes/GCC10 Switch GCC in Fedora 32 to 10.x.y, rebuild all packages with it, or optionally rebuild just some packages with it and rebuild all packages only in Fedora 33.
